#0eff2f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0eff2f is composed of 5.5% red, 100%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 128.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 52.7%. #0eff2f color hex could be obtained by blending #1cff5e with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#0eff2f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e02 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#0eff2f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d9080 is the less saturated color, while #0eff2f is the most saturated one.
